Coefficient of static and kinetic friction problem


A dockworker loading crates on a ship finds that a 22 kg crate, initially at rest on a horizontal surface, requires a 73.2 N horizontal force to set it in motion. However, after the crate is set in motion, a horizontal force of 52 N is required to keep it moving with a constant speed. Find the coefficient of static and kinetic friction between the crate and the floor. The acceleration of gravity is 9.8 m/s^2. Please show work.
